The Washington Farmers Market begins its 2025 season on Saturday, June 7th, running every Saturday from 8 a.m. to 2 p.m. at The Commons, 301 E Main Street, Washington, Indiana, continuing through mid-October.

Shoppers can explore vibrant stalls filled with fresh, locally grown fruits and vegetables bursting with flavor. Vendors are eager to share the stories behind their products, creating a friendly and welcoming atmosphere.

In addition to fresh produce, the market offers a diverse selection of handmade crafts and artisanal goods—ideal for gifts or unique additions to any home—while supporting the talents of local growers and artists. This weekly event is a perfect way to enjoy the best of downtown Washington throughout the summer and fall seasons.
